The Road to Become Immortal

I woke up and found a shining crystal on the table behind my bed. I looked closely; there wasn’t a note attached to it. I picked up the crystal and read aloud: “You are a lucky one. If you want to be immortal, put this crystal in the sword located in the Ice Cave on the Ice Mountain.” I thought for a while and decided to accept the challenge. I changed my clothes, packed my bag, carefully put the crystal in my pocket, and started the journey to become immortal.

I took a taxi to the legendary blacksmith’s shop. It was called “legendary” because it had all kinds of famous swords and shields. I told the shopkeeper I wanted the best sword available. He handed me a sword with curly spikes along the blade and a magical aura swirling around it. I bought it, took a taxi again, and went to the foot of the ancient Ice Mountain. There were barely any people around.

I asked a man nearby, “How do I get to the Ice Cave? ”Kid, don’t you dare go to the Ice Cave,” he warned. “A lot of people have tried to go there, but they all died.” “I don’t care—just tell me where it is!” I said. “Fine, if you’re so determined. Follow the path up there and you’ll find the Ice Cave,” he replied. “Be careful!”

I followed the path and saw the ice; at first it didn’t look so dangerous. I walked inside and saw the sword gleaming. I stepped forward toward it, but suddenly a yeti appeared beside the sword and roared. I was petrified for a moment, then gripped my sword tightly and fought back. The yeti was strong and landed heavy punches and kicks. It threw a punch at me, but I blocked it, moved behind it, and stabbed it in the chest. The yeti roared loudly and, in desperation, threw ice shuriken’s that cut my arm. I pulled one out, then hurled my sword at the yeti with all my strength. It fell to the ground and vanished. I walked to the sword with blood dripping from my arm.

I took the crystal and placed it into the sword. The blade flew into my hand, and a surge of power ran through my body. My wound healed instantly. I screamed, “I did it—finally!”
